Full Description
This examination highlights significant educational reform movements throughout the 20th century, analyzing their origins, developments, and impacts. Key reforms such as Montessori, Progressive Education, and others will be discussed.
Understanding these reforms is essential for recognizing the shifts in educational paradigms and their implications for modern pedagogical practices. These movements often arose in response to social changes, necessitating an informed evaluation.
Students will be assessed on their ability to articulate the motivations behind these reform movements, describe their historical context, and analyze their lasting effects on education today.
Candidates should prepare to discuss specific reforms, emphasizing critical thinking and clear articulation of their significance.
Sample Questions
- What were the primary motivations behind the Montessori method of education?
- How did Progressive Education respond to societal changes in the early 20th century?
